Former World Championship Runner-Up Makes Controversial Statement

While the community is focusing its attention on domestic tournaments, especially the LCK – where the LCK Cup 2026 has been full of surprises, the LPL in China is also quite lively. Notably, BLG has made headlines with the addition of Viper during the recent transfer window. However, up to now, BLG has not demonstrated the expected strength and has instead drawn attention mainly due to… the statements of former World Championship runner-up – Bin.

Specifically, right after BLG’s recent loss to AL, Bin confidently posted on social media Weibo stating: “I am still the best top laner in the world.”

Of course, this statement from Bin after a loss for BLG will spark controversy. Some opinions suggest that Bin remains “unchanged” and has not been humble after BLG’s decline and failures over the past time. Not to mention, Bin’s BLG even failed to get past the Swiss Stage of last year’s World Championship.

However, on the flip side, many viewers believe that this is a very normal action from Bin and shows that he still has a lot of motivation to compete. Moreover, BLG is currently in an unstable state. Some positive thoughts suggest that Bin’s actions could help his teammates, like Knight – who performed very poorly in the recent match against AL, avoid unnecessary criticism.

But the former World Championship runner-up must bounce back immediately

The first split of the LPL has passed the halfway point, and there is still no certainty that BLG will be a strong contender for the title or participate in the upcoming First Stand. With a team that holds much hope and has welcomed a “blockbuster signing” like Viper, this is very hard to accept, and BLG needs to bounce back immediately if they don’t want the audience to run out of patience.
